The Scene in Question

In Season 2 of Euphoria, Cassie Howard, played by Sweeney, engages in a sexually explicit scene that is both raw and unsettling. The scene is not merely about physical intimacy but serves as a culmination of Cassie’s emotional unraveling throughout the season. Her character, struggling with self-worth and validation, uses sex as a coping mechanism, often at the expense of her own dignity. The scene is shot with a stark realism that leaves viewers uncomfortable, which was arguably the intent of the show’s creator, Sam Levinson.

However, it was Sweeney’s comments about the scene in interviews that fueled the controversy. She revealed that she had initially pushed back against the scene, feeling it was unnecessary for the narrative. Sweeney’s concern was not about the explicit nature of the scene itself but about its purpose within the story. She questioned whether it added depth to Cassie’s character or merely served as gratuitous content.

Sweeney’s reservations touched on a critical issue in the entertainment industry: the treatment of actors, particularly women, in intimate scenes. Historically, female actors have often been pressured into performing scenes they were uncomfortable with, raising questions about consent and agency. Sweeney’s willingness to speak out about her discomfort highlighted the progress being made in advocating for actors’ rights, but it also underscored how far the industry still has to go.

The Role of the Creator: Intent vs. Interpretation

Sam Levinson, the creator of Euphoria, has been both praised and criticized for his approach to sensitive topics. Levinson has stated that the show aims to portray the raw, unfiltered experiences of its young characters, often without judgment. In the case of Cassie’s scene, Levinson argued that it was essential to understanding her character’s arc.

"The scene wasn’t about titillation; it was about exposing the fragility and desperation of a character who’s lost her way," Levinson explained in an interview with *Variety*.

However, intent does not always align with interpretation. Some viewers felt the scene crossed a line, arguing that it exploited Sweeney’s character for shock value rather than serving the narrative. This disconnect between creator intent and audience perception is a recurring theme in discussions about provocative content.

Moving Forward: Lessons for the Industry

The debate over Sweeney’s scene has broader implications for how the industry approaches intimate content. It has prompted calls for greater transparency and collaboration between creators and actors, as well as the implementation of safeguards to protect performers. Initiatives like the use of intimacy coordinators, now standard on many sets, are steps in the right direction.

Steps Toward Ethical Portrayals of Intimacy:

  1. Clear Communication: Actors should be fully briefed on the purpose and context of intimate scenes.
  2. Consent Protocols: Performers must have the right to negotiate or refuse scenes they are uncomfortable with.
  3. Intimacy Coordination: Professionals should be on set to ensure scenes are choreographed safely and respectfully.
  4. Audience Awareness: Creators must consider how their work will be interpreted and its potential impact on viewers.
